1. Generative AI (GenAI): Your Winning Content Strategy:

Generative AI uses advanced neural networks and deep learning to create relevant, organic content from learned patterns. It analyzes large datasets with sophisticated algorithms to produce high-quality text, code, or imagery based on user input.

By 2025, GenAI systems will feature contextual understanding, multimodal processing, and real-time adaptation, making them essential for content creation, product development, and decision-making. This technology can cut content creation costs and empower businesses to steer their marketing goals to match their target demographic.

2. Quantum Computing: Pushing the Boundaries of Big Data Management

Don’t be overwhelmed by the name, quantum computing serves the basic function of performing complex calculations much faster than those old, clunky computers, using process of “superposition” and “entanglement”. By using quantum bits (qubits) that can exist in multiple states at once, it enables unprecedented parallel processing.

In 2025, cloud-based quantum platforms make it possible for enterprises to solve complex problems in life-like simulation and cryptography in minutes rather than years, particularly benefiting areas like financial modeling and order fulfilment.

3. Edge Computing and IoT: Accelerating Business Operations:

Edge computing decentralizes data processing by moving computation closer to data sources, while IoT creates a network of interconnected smart devices generating real-time data.?

This architectural approach minimizes latency by processing data at or near its source, rather than sending it to centralized cloud servers. In 2025, the integration of Microsoft Power BI with edge computing enables real-time analytics and visualization at the network edge.

4. “Hyper-Automation”: Improving Workflows for Improved Outputs:?

Historically, the word “automation” was mostly confined to individual workflows - not anymore. Hyper automation brings ultra-futuristic technologies like RPA, IoT, and machine learning to automate multiple workflows across the digital infrastructure, simultaneously.

That way, hyper automation platforms will provide end-to-end automation with built-in analytics, aiming to cut operational costs by 40% while achieving near-100% process accuracy.

5. AI Governance: A New Era of Ethical AI:

AI governance involves the tools and methods used to ensure that artificial intelligence (AI) is used ethically and with 100% regulatory compliance. This approach includes detecting bias automatically, providing transparency, and continuously monitoring systems, which can work with platforms like Microsoft Power BI.

AI governance now also includes monitoring compliance, assessing risks automatically and enforcing policies dynamically. The key benefit of this governance is lower AI-related risks by 80%, while ensuring that all tech implementations follow compliance laws.

6. Green Computing: Driving Sustainability in Enterprise Tech:

Green computing integrates environmental sustainability into enterprise technology infrastructure through energy-efficient hardware, optimized software design, and sustainable data center practices. This approach encompasses power management systems, thermal optimization, and carbon-aware computing schedules.?

Therefore, green computing may contribute to significant energy cost reductions while meeting increasingly stringent environmental regulations and enhancing brand value.
